Business Overview
A-Star Sports Nets is a leading force in Australian sports facilities, specialising in sports netting solutions for elite-level clubs and organisations across the AFL, NRL, Cricket, Rugby, Soccer, and Golf, as well as world-class facilities for private schools, councils, and high-end commercial projects. Based in Carrum Downs, Melbourne, with a growing presence in Sydney, we deliver cutting-edge projects that shape the future of Australian sports facilities.

About the role
You’ll help our Site Manager and small team get jobs done on time and safely. This is hands-on work that requires a level of strength, fitness, and stamina with your days comprising of lifting, measuring, setting out, installing nets, supporting concrete works, footings, crane operations, and other civil tasks. You’ll work safely at heights, rigging, and hanging nets, and use tools and equipment correctly (training provided). You’ll assist with daily site tasks, handle materials, keep the site organised and efficient, and travel across Victoria or interstate as needed.
